在SQL Server中使用存储过程生成表的数据脚本文件可以通过以下步骤实现:
以下是一个示例存储过程的代码:
CREATE PROCEDURE GenerateDataScript
AS
BEGIN
-- 查询表的数据
SELECT * INTO #TempTable FROM YourTableName
-- 生成数据脚本
SELECT * FROM #TempTable
INTO OUTFILE 'C:\Path\To\Script.sql'
FIELDS TERMINATED BY ',' OPTIONALLY ENCLOSED BY '"'
LINES TERMINATED BY '\n';
-- 删除临时表
DROP TABLE #TempTable
END
请注意,上述示例中的"YourTableName"应替换为实际的表名,"C:\Path\To\Script.sql"应替换为实际的文件路径和文件名。
推荐的腾讯云相关产品:腾讯云数据库SQL Server版(https://cloud.tencent.com/product/sqlserver)可以提供稳定可靠的SQL Server数据库服务,支持存储过程和数据导出功能。
领取专属 10元无门槛券
手把手带您无忧上云